Roasted Mixed Potatoes with Spring Herbs and Burrata

1.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F.2. On a large baking sheet, toss together 2 tablespoons olive oil, the potatoes, garlic, lemon juice, and a small pinch each of salt and pepper. Transfer to the oven and roast for 20 minutes, toss and continue roasting another 20-25 minutes or until golden and crisp.3. Meanwhile, in a small bowl combine remaining 2 tablespoons of olive oil, dill, basil, chives, and lemon zest. Season with salt and pepper. 5. Remove the potatoes from the oven and transfer to a serving plate. Break the burrata over the potatoes and then drizzle with the lemon herb mix. Eat!
